[发明专利]多进程动画切换方法、装置及显示屏在审

专利信息
申请号: 201711020268.1 申请日: 2017-10-26
公开(公告)号: CN107729064A 公开(公告)日: 2018-02-23
发明(设计)人: 钱苏晋;刘爱军;向茂军 申请(专利权)人: 北京恒泰实达科技股份有限公司
主分类号: G06F9/44 分类号: G06F9/44;G06F9/48
代理公司: 北京超凡志成知识产权代理事务所(普通合伙)11371 代理人: 王术兰
地址: 100000 北京市海淀*** 国省代码: 北京;11
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 进程 动画 切换 方法 装置 显示屏
【说明书】:

技术领域

发明涉及显示技术领域,尤其是涉及一种多进程动画切换方法、装置及显示屏。

背景技术

目前应用于大屏的播放器方案多为启用多个播放器进程,每个进程播放一个画面场景,当需要场(一幅画面)显示时,将此场所在的播放器窗体激活并置顶,需要进行画面切换。由于操作系统的限制无法做到对两个独立的窗体进行动画过渡,在切换时有以下两种方式:

(1)不隐藏窗体,只切换窗体的Z序(当前窗口从屏幕底部到屏幕最高层的窗口句柄的排序)到最前面。此方式会有较大的渲染压力,有很大的几率会导致系统无法响应渲染而导致消息队列堵死的假象。

(2)先隐藏上场画面,再显示当前场画面。此方式有几率因为出现上场画面隐藏后当前场画面还没显示出来而导致的“漏桌面”(显示空窗期,即无任何窗体处于显示状态)的情况。

因此上述播放器的画面切换方法的切换效果差。

发明内容

有鉴于此,本发明的目的在于提供一种多进程动画切换方法、装置及显示屏,可以提高进程切换时的显示效果。

第一方面,本发明实施例提供了一种多进程动画切换方法,应用于播放器,该方法包括:在接收到进程切换指令时,控制进程控制播放器的当前进程暂停工作;控制进程采集当前进程的UI快照;根据当前进程的UI快照和预先存储的欲切换进程的UI快照执行动画;控制进程控制欲切换进程进行显示并恢复工作。

结合第一方面,本发明实施例提供了第一方面的第一种可能的实施方式,其中,控制进程为采用Master机制管理渲染Agent的管理进程。

结合第一方面,本发明实施例提供了第一方面的第二种可能的实施方式,控制进程控制播放器的当前进程暂停工作的步骤之前,还包括:控制进程申请切换资源锁,在申请成功后执行控制进程控制播放器的当前进程暂停工作的步骤。

结合第一方面,本发明实施例提供了第一方面的第三种可能的实施方式,其中,控制进程采集当前进程的UI快照的步骤,包括:控制进程对当前进程按照Master的窗体位置进行屏幕截图;拷贝屏幕截图作为当前进程的UI快照。

结合第一方面,本发明实施例提供了第一方面的第四种可能的实施方式,其中,根据当前进程的UI快照和预先存储的欲切换进程的UI快照执行动画的步骤,包括:提取预先存储的欲切换进程的UI快照;按照系统预定规则将当前进程的UI快照和欲切换进程的UI快照的动画进行显示。

结合第一方面,本发明实施例提供了第一方面的第五种可能的实施方式,在控制进程控制欲切换进程进行显示并恢复工作的步骤之后,还包括:控制进程广播切换完成的通知消息,以使连接设备的显示画面同步。

结合第一方面的第二种可能的实施方式,本发明实施例提供了第一方面的第六种可能的实施方式,其中,在控制进程控制欲切换进程进行显示并恢复工作的步骤之后,还包括:控制进程释放切换资源锁。

第二方面,本发明实施例还提供一种多进程动画切换装置,应用于播放器,该装置包括:暂停模块,用于在接收到进程切换指令时,通过控制进程控制播放器的当前进程暂停工作;采集模块,用于通过控制进程采集当前进程的UI快照;动画执行模块,用于根据当前进程的UI快照和预先存储的欲切换进程的UI快照执行动画;切换模块,用于通过控制进程控制欲切换进程进行显示并恢复工作。

第三方面,本发明实施例还提供一种显示屏,包括处理器和机器可读存储介质,机器可读存储介质存储有能够被处理器执行的机器可执行指令,处理器执行机器可执行指令以实现第一方面及其各可能的实施方式之一提供的方法。

第四方面,本发明实施例还提供一种机器可读存储介质,机器可读存储介质存储有机器可执行指令,机器可执行指令在被处理器调用和执行时,机器可执行指令促使处理器实现第一方面及其各可能的实施方式之一提供的方法。

本发明实施例带来了以下有益效果:本发明实施例提供的多进程动画切换方法、装置及显示屏,在进行进程切换时,先暂停当前进程并根据当前进程的UI快照和预先存储的欲切换进程的UI快照执行动画,再控制欲切换进程进行显示并恢复工作,通过两个进程的UI快照的动画显示,可以提高进程切换时的显示效果,实现画面无缝过渡切换。

本发明的其他特征和优点将在随后的说明书中阐述,或者,部分特征和优点可以从说明书推知或毫无疑义地确定,或者通过实施本发明的上述技术即可得知。

为使本发明的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。

附图说明

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京恒泰实达科技股份有限公司,未经北京恒泰实达科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/201711020268.1/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top